El Presidente Posted August 27, 2023 Posted August 27, 2023 They just can't help themselves. __________________________________________________________________________________________________________- The Department of Energy has defended its plan to introduce new requirements for ceiling fans, insisting that they would save households energy. The Energy Department believes ceiling fans which comply with the new rules would save households about $39 over their lifespan - a saving of 40 percent - and cost customers around $10 more for each fan. 1 1
